    Dynamic VSync shuts down VSync when FPS drops below refresh rate, so there is no need for Triple buffering/Double buffering.

    I don't see a reason for forcing Triple buffering.

    Vsync does not get disabled until framerate drops below DVC's threshold (currently 5%), if you don't have triple-buffering enabled then framerate would drop from 60 to 30 FPS when the game can't sustain 60 FPS (assuming a 60 Hz monitor)
